One example that stands out occurred last spring when our platform experienced a surge of high-value transactions from multiple accounts. On the surface, each account appeared legitimate with unique billing and shipping details. Traditional fraud checks didn’t flag anything, but IPQS security tools revealed that all these accounts shared the same device fingerprint. Acting on this information, I blocked the fraudulent accounts before any transactions were completed, saving the company several thousand dollars. Experiences like this taught me that device-level intelligence often uncovers patterns that conventional checks miss.

I’ve also relied on IPQS security tools to detect automated bot activity. One weekend, our platform saw an unusually high number of new account registrations. Each account looked legitimate at first glance, but examining device fingerprints, operating systems, and browser configurations revealed patterns consistent with automated bots. By addressing these accounts early, we avoided disruption to the platform and protected real users from the effects of automated attacks. In my experience, being able to detect bots before they impact the system is one of the most valuable features of IPQS security tools.
